A humble man and a religious man, who worked as a presser in a laundry, Ezra Siman Tov was also a teller of stories, stories that enthralled and captivate his friends in their old Nachlaot neighbourhood of Jerusalem. His brother-in-law, Dr Tawil, gives him a grudging respect, the Torah scholars listen surreptitiously and the Great Writer - SY Agnon - took his stories and gave them form. But along with his stories, Ezra also has a shame and a secret, which overshadowed his family. And his secret suffering never left himquite free.Haim Sabato, the award winning writer, recreates a lost world in which faith provides a framework for life and a deep source of comfort. A bestseller in Israel among both secular and religious readers, The Dawning Of The Day is a solace and comfort for all. It has been translated by Yaacob Dweck from the original Hebrew.
